About Senior Shipping and Receiving Specialist

  Overview

  The Senior Shipping and Receiving Specialist contributes to REI’s success by coordinating the warehouse and product movement functions of the store while executing store shipping and receiving functions. They train and act as a role model in the knowledge, skills, and tasks that deliver exceptional customer experience. In addition, the Senior Shipping and Receiving Specialist accomplishes planning and execution of events as well as operational and administrative tasks that support daily department function per the direction of the Department Manager. This role models and acts in accordance with REI’s guiding values and mission.

  Responsibilities and Qualifications

  Key Responsibilities:

  • Plan and deliver training to store employees as instructed by Department Manager. Training ensures delivery of all department and store functions, including additional training initiatives from management.

  • Model desired department and store behaviors as defined by the Management Team. Demonstrate initiative and productivity and serve as a role model for store employees.

  • Coordinate execution of daily shipping and product movement tasks and priorities from Management Team. Ask department and store employees for help executing daily tasks as needed. • Plan event inventory logistics plus plan sale setup, floorset execution, and all additional administrative and operational department tasks as assigned by Department Manager.

  • Communicate priorities and tasks, promotional events, and important news to department and store employees utilizing communication methods identified by Management Team and REI.

  • Identify opportunities for additional staff training, notify Department Manager, and plan and deliver as assigned.

  • Share feedback with Department Managers regarding staffing and scheduling needs.

  • Identify areas of opportunity and act on them as it relates to inventory accuracy, price accuracy, and product stock levels. Elevate concerns or ideas to Department Manager.

  • Effectively prepare the store for customers: coordinate daily stocking process, execution of visual direction, and ensure a compelling presentation. Partner with Department Manager of Visual Merchandising to ensure visual excellence.

  • Sign out department keys and technology devices to employees.

  • Assist Point of Sale through ringing transaction, answering questions, and overriding the register as needed.

  • Embrace change and support all management change initiatives.

  • Implement and promote adoption of REI’s Standard Operating Procedures.

  • Consistent, sincere effort to invite and welcome new members to REI Co-op, promote Co-brand credit card and Cooperative Action Fund.

  • Support inclusive and welcoming store and department for employees and customers. • Participate and engage in small group discussions.

  • Maintain an organized, efficient warehouse space and inventory that supports efficient sales floor replenishment and Visual Merchandising activities.

  • Train and act as a role model to Shipping and Receiving Specialists in shipping and receiving functions as required while being competent in all required shipping and receiving job functions.

  • Verify the accuracy of incoming/outgoing shipments by comparing items and quantities against bills of lading, invoices, manifests, or other records according to REI policy and procedure.

  • Receive vendor and internal shipments according to REI policy and procedure. 10/12/2023 Page 2 of 3 • Price, organize, evaluate or ship customer and product quality returns according to stated REI policies and procedures.

  • Process and track inventory transfers, vendor or quality returns in a timely and accurate fashion according to REI procedures.

  • Provide effective 2-way communication between cross divisional partners and REI customers and staff • Follow Asset Protection and safety procedures as directed by store management.

  • Assume responsibility for other functions as directed by management team such as recycling, trash removal or simple maintenance tasks.

  • Support Physical Inventory processes, planning, and routine inventory audits as directed by Management Team.

  • Ensure compliance to hazardous waste program, including maintaining storage area and coordination of hazardous waste pickup.

  • Re/Supply processing, replenishment, and merchandising.

  • Pick, process, and ship Fulfillment orders as needed.

  • Perform all other duties and tasks assigned.

  Pay Range

  $19.90 - $23.40 per hour
